devdraw: OS X unicode input (Andrey Mirtchovski)
diff --git a/src/cmd/devdraw/osx-screen.c b/src/cmd/devdraw/osx-screen.c
index af489f3..a196252 100644
--- a/src/cmd/devdraw/osx-screen.c
+++ b/src/cmd/devdraw/osx-screen.c
@@ -427,6 +427,13 @@
 			k = keycvt[code];
 		if(k >= 0)
 			keystroke(k);
+		else{
+			UniChar ch;
+			GetEventParameter(event, kEventParamKeyUnicodes,
+				typeUnicodeText, nil, sizeof uc, nil, &uc);
+			if(uc >= 0)
+				keystroke(uc);
+		}
 		break;
 
 	case kEventRawKeyModifiersChanged: